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A): Hybrid in Charlotte, NC
Charlotte, NC (50% in-person and 50% remote)
$110k base salary
Performance bonus opportunity
$20,000 sign-on bonus
Full suite of healthcare benefits
Overview
Our company is seeking a BCBA to join its growing team. This hybrid role offers the opportunity to provide high-quality ABA services while maintaining flexibility, professional development, and strong clinical support.
Position Summary
The BCBA will oversee ABA treatment programs for children with autism, conduct assessments, develop treatment plans, supervise RBTs, and partner with families to drive meaningful client outcomes.
Key Responsibilities
Conduct behavioral assessments and create individualized treatment plans
Supervise and mentor Registered Behavior Technicians (RBTs)
Monitor client progress and adjust treatment plans as needed
Provide parent training and caregiver support
Maintain accurate clinical documentation and compliance standards
Collaborate with interdisciplinary teams to ensure quality care
